Skip to content

Components Status

smicyk edited this page Mar 2, 2024 · 6 revisions

Plan

keyword component supported
plan Test Plan ✔️

Group

keyword component supported
after tearDown Thread Group ✔️
before setUp Thread Group ✔️
group Thread Group ✔️
schedule Open Model Thread Group ✔️

Controller

keyword component supported
execute ✔️
execute_if If Controller ✔️
execute_interleave Interleave Controller ✔️
execute_once Once Only Controller ✔️
execute_order Random Order Controller ✔️
execute_percent Throughput Controller ✔️
execute_random Random Controller ✔️
execute_runtime Runtime Controller ✔️
execute_switch Switch Controller ✔️
execute_total Throughput Controller ✔️
execute_while While Controller ✔️
for_each ForEach Controller ✔️
include Include Controller ✔️
include_raw ✔️
loop Loop Controller ✔️
section Critical Section Controller ✔️
simple Simple Controller ✔️
transaction Transaction Controller ✔️
request enhancement Module Controller
Recording Controller ❌ - no plans

Sampler

keyword component supported
ajp HTTP Request ✔️
debug Debug Sampler ✔️
flow Flow Control Action ✔️
graphql HTTP Request ✔️
http HTTP Request ✔️
java_request Java Request ✔️
jdbc_request JDBC Request ✔️
jsrsampler JSR223 Sampler ✔️
request enhancement FTP Request
request enhancement LDAP Request
request enhancement LDAP Extended Request
request enhancement Access Log Sampler
BeanShell Sampler ❌ - no plans
request enhancement TCP Sampler
request enhancement JMS Publisher
request enhancement JMS Subscriber
request enhancement JMS Point-to-Point
request enhancement Mail Reader Sampler
request enhancement SMTP Sampler
request enhancement OS Process Sampler
request enhancement Bolt Request

Timer

keyword component supported
constant_throughput Constant Throughput Timer ✔️
constant_timer Constant Timer ✔️
gaussian_timer Gaussian Random Timer ✔️
jsrtimer JSR223 Timer ✔️
poisson_timer Poisson Random Timer ✔️
precise_throughput Precise Throughput Timer ✔️
synchronizing_timer Synchronizing Timer ✔️
throughput ✔️
timer ✔️
uniform_timer Uniform Random Timer ✔️

Extractor

keyword component supported
extract_css CSS Selector Extractor ✔️
extract_jmes JSON JMESPath Extractor ✔️
extract_json JSON Extractor ✔️
extract_regex Regular Expression Extractor ✔️
extract_xpath XPath2 Extractor ✔️
request enhancement XPath Extractor
request enhancement Result Status Action Handler
request enhancement Boundary Extractor

Postprocessor

keyword component supported
debug_postprocessor Debug PostProcessor ✔️
jdbc_postprocessor JDBC PostProcessor ✔️
jsrpostprocessor JSR223 PostProcessor ✔️
BeanShell PostProcessor ❌ - no plans
request enhancement Debug PostProcessor

Preprocessor

keyword component supported
jdbc_preprocessor JDBC PreProcessor ✔️
jsrpreprocessor JSR223 PreProcessor ✔️
request enhancement HTML Link Parser
request enhancement HTTP URL Re-writing Modifier
request enhancement User Parameters
BeanShell PreProcessor ❌ - no plans
request enhancement RegEx User Parameters
request enhancement Sample Timeout

Assertion

keyword component supported
assert_duration Duration Assertion ✔️
assert_jmes JSON JMESPath Assertion ✔️
assert_json JSON Assertion ✔️
assert_md5hex MD5Hex Assertion ✔️
assert_response Response Assertion ✔️
assert_size Size Assertion ✔️
assert_xpath XPath Assertion ✔️
jsrassertion JSR223 Assertion ✔️
request enhancement XML Assertion
BeanShell Assertion ❌ - no plans
request enhancement HTML Assertion
request enhancement XPath2 Assertion
request enhancement XML Schema Assertion
request enhancement Compare Assertion
request enhancement SMIME Assertion

Config

keyword component supported
authorization ✔️
authorizations HTTP Authorization Manager ✔️
cache HTTP Cache Manager ✔️
cookie ✔️
cookies HTTP Cookie Manager ✔️
counter Counter ✔️
csv CSV Data Set Config ✔️
defaults HTTP Request Defaults ✔️
dns DNS Cache Manager ✔️
header ✔️
headers HTTP Header Manager ✔️
jdbc ✔️
jdbc_config JDBC Connection Configuration ✔️
login Login Config Element ✔️
random Random Variable ✔️
variable ✔️
variables User Defined Variables ✔️
request enhancement FTP Request Defaults
request enhancement Java Request Defaults
request enhancement Keystore Configuration
request enhancement LDAP Request Defaults
request enhancement LDAP Extended Request Defaults
request enhancement TCP Sampler Config
request enhancement Simple Config Element
request enhancement Bolt Connection Configuration

Listener

keyword component supported
aggregate Aggregate Report ✔️
backend Backend Listener ✔️
jsrlistener JSR223 Listener ✔️
summary Summary Report ✔️
view View Results Tree ✔️
request enhancement Sample Result Save Configuration
request enhancement Graph Results
request enhancement Assertion Results
request enhancement View Results in Table
request enhancement Simple Data Writer
request enhancement Aggregate Graph
request enhancement Response Time Graph
request enhancement Mail Visualizer
request enhancement BeanShell Listener
request enhancement Save Response to a file
request enhancement Generate Summary Results
request enhancement Mail Visualizer
request enhancement Comparison Assertion Visualizer

Check

keyword component supported
check_request Response Assertion ✔️
check_response Response Assertion ✔️
check_size Response Assertion ✔️

Other

keyword component supported
insert ✔️
Clone this wiki locally